Introduction to "Health Literacy from A to Z: Practical Ways to Communicate Your Health Message"
Welcome to Health Literacy from A to Z: Practical Ways to Communicate Your Health Message, a comprehensive guide dedicated to improving how healthcare providers, educators, public health professionals, and anyone involved in health communication convey vital information. Written by Helen Osborne, this insightful book is designed to equip readers with the tools and strategies needed to enhance health communication for diverse communities, ensuring that critical health information is accessible, inclusive, and actionable.
Health literacy plays a pivotal role in helping individuals and communities effectively understand, process, and act on health-related information. This book provides practical, clear, and easy-to-implement guidance to address complex communication challenges. Whether you are a seasoned health professional or new to the field, this book offers a step-by-step roadmap to sharpen your communication skills, foster understanding, and empower people to make informed healthcare decisions.
Detailed Summary of the Book
Divided into 26 alphabetical chapters—one for each letter of the alphabet—Health Literacy from A to Z serves as both a reference guide and an instructional manual. Each chapter focuses on a specific aspect of health literacy, blending theory with practical strategies. The goal is to address common challenges that healthcare professionals face when communicating with patients who have varying levels of literacy, cultural backgrounds, and health knowledge.
Topics include crafting clear health messages, building trust, addressing cultural differences, using plain language, and utilizing visual aids. Osborne introduces tools such as "Teach-Back" and "Ask Me 3" methods, offering realistic examples that can be applied in clinical settings, public health campaigns, and community outreach programs.
What sets this book apart is its intuitive organization and accessibility. Whether you need quick tips or in-depth knowledge on a particular topic, Osborne ensures that readers can easily find what they need. Furthermore, chapters include real-life anecdotes, thought-provoking exercises, and checklists to help readers put concepts into practice.
Key Takeaways
- Practical advice on how to simplify complex health information without sacrificing accuracy.
- Methods to identify and bridge the communication gap between healthcare professionals and patients.
- Effective strategies for addressing cultural and linguistic diversity in health communication.
- Insights on the importance of empathy, active listening, and patient-centered care.
- How to utilize tools such as plain language, visual aids, and summaries to improve understanding.
These takeaways empower healthcare providers to build stronger relationships with patients and communities. By boosting health literacy, we create environments where individuals are more capable of making informed decisions about their health and well-being.

Why This Book Matters
In today’s fast-paced world, access to clear, reliable health information is vital. Yet, millions of people struggle to navigate healthcare systems or understand instructions about their health. Low health literacy is a widespread barrier to achieving optimal healthcare outcomes. This is where Health Literacy from A to Z makes a difference.
By addressing the challenges that prevent proper understanding of health information, this book serves as a critical resource for both healthcare practitioners and patients. It encourages better communication that fosters trust, supports equitable access to care, and empowers individuals to advocate for their own health needs.
Ultimately, improving health literacy isn’t just about delivering information; it’s about empowering people to lead healthier lives. This book provides the actionable tools and guidance needed to make that vision a reality.
